“ There are basically two types of people. People who accomplish things, and people who claim to have accomplished things. The first group is less crowded. ”

Meaning

This quote means the people who truly achieve are usually fewer than those who merely claim credit. Real accomplishment is quieter than boasting.

Mark Twain, born Samuel Clemens, was an American author and humorist known for classics like Adventures of Huckleberry Finn. His quotes often reflect wit, social critique, and human insight. Twain inspires writers, readers, and social thinkers to explore human nature, challenge conventions, and communicate ideas with humor and intelligence.
